Product Description

Smooth-Cast™ 326

The Smooth-Cast™ 325, 326 & 327 ColorMatch™ Series plastics are fast-cast resins that were developed specifically for adding color pigments and fillers to achieve true color representation or filler effect. The ColorMatch™ Series is formulated “color neutral”. Small amounts of pigment will yield accurate, vivid colors from cured castings using So-Strong™ tints or Ignite™ color pigments. The ColorMatch™ Series offers the convenience of a 1A: 1B mix ratio by volume and has a very low viscosity. Demold times range from about 10 minutes to 2-4 hours (depending on product, mass and mold configuration). Note: Large mass castings will get very hot and shrink more, depending on mold configuration.

The ColorMatch™ Series also readily accept fillers (such as URE-FIL™ 3 from Smooth-On). Applications for the ColorMatch™ Series plastics include making pigmented prototype models or figures, special effect props, reproducing small to medium size sculptures, decorative jewelry, etc.

EpoxAcast™ 650 + 102 Hardener

EpoxAcast™ 650 is a mineral filled general purpose casting epoxy resin that is low cost and versatile. It features a low mixed viscosity for minimal bubble entrapment.
